Plexiform Schwannoma of the Tongue in a Pediatric Patient with Neurofibromatosis Type 2: A Case Report and Review of Literature
Figure 2
Histology of plexiform schwannoma. (a) Tumor cells forming interlacing fascicles and nodules (plexiform growth) (H&E, X20). (b) Cellular area with Verocay bodies (arrow), formed by palisading of nuclei and separated by cell processes of Schwann cells (H&E, X100). (c) Tumor cells are strongly and diffusely positive for S-100 (X100). (d) EMA-positive perineural fibroblasts surrounding nodules (X40).
